.class public abstract Lcom/google/firebase/auth/MultiFactorResolver; .super Lcom/google/android/gms/common/internal/safeparcel/AbstractSafeParcelable; .source "com.google.firebase:firebase-auth@@21.0.1" # direct methods .method public constructor ()V .locals 0 .line 1 invoke-direct {p0}, Lcom/google/android/gms/common/internal/safeparcel/AbstractSafeParcelable;->()V return-void .end method # virtual methods .method public abstract getFirebaseAuth()Lcom/google/firebase/auth/FirebaseAuth; .annotation build Landroidx/annotation/NonNull; .end annotation .end method .method public abstract getHints()Ljava/util/List; .annotation build Landroidx/annotation/NonNull; .end annotation .annotation system Ldalvik/annotation/Signature; value = { "()", "Ljava/util/List<", "Lcom/google/firebase/auth/MultiFactorInfo;", ">;" } .end annotation .end method .method public abstract getSession()Lcom/google/firebase/auth/MultiFactorSession; .annotation build Landroidx/annotation/NonNull; .end annotation .end method .method public abstract resolveSignIn(Lcom/google/firebase/auth/MultiFactorAssertion;)Lcom/google/android/gms/tasks/Task; .param p1 # Lcom/google/firebase/auth/MultiFactorAssertion; .annotation build Landroidx/annotation/NonNull; .end annotation .end param .annotation build Landroidx/annotation/NonNull; .end annotation .annotation system Ldalvik/annotation/Signature; value = { "(", "Lcom/google/firebase/auth/MultiFactorAssertion;", ")", "Lcom/google/android/gms/tasks/Task<", "Lcom/google/firebase/auth/AuthResult;", ">;" } .end annotation .end method